That's the factory bezel and the "dvd slot" is for the factory navigation system's buttons.

 

Also since most carPC screens are 7" and I believe the factory screen was 6.5", the factory navigation bezel isn't going to work.

That bezel will NOT work for a GT. That will only work on a 2.5i because they have single zone climate controls with knobs. You cannot custom fab the controls in there either because the actual climate controls are built into the radio unit itself. It's quite an involved process.

Dont worry about cable length, you wont have any issues running the wires all the way from the back of the trunk. Degredation doesnt play an issue here.

My CarPC is a laptop mounted over the spare tire. I have a USB cable running from the laptop to a passive hub in the dashboard, which connects to my Tactrix cable, USB display, WBO2, and a cable that's accessible from the cabin, for thumb drives and occasionally a keyboard.

 

And just for completeness... the laptop's other USB port goes to powered hub, which connects to the power-hungry stuff: bluetooth, WiFi, and GPS.

I seem to recall the factory screen being smaller than "standard" car PC screens. I put "standard" in quotes because there are different sized 7" LCD screens depending on what brand you buy.

 

I personally wouldn't buy the factory nav bezel and get the standard cubby bezel instead.

 

I think this is the part: http://www.subaruparts.com/cart/?pn=66060ag05a but check with them before you order.

 

You'll have to cut it up and fabricate it to fit your screen. I would use the front of the plastic housing that your screen comes in.

 

I find http://www.plastidip.com/home_solutions/Plasti_Dip to be a suitable match to the dash with a soft rubberized feel to it.

After years of trying I have just about had it with CarPC. I cannot believe what a retard I was for ever going down this path. Guys, buy a commercial solution - do not piece it together yourself. When it breaks - and it is guaranteed to break - it is YOU who will have to fix it. As an aside, if you do get a CarPC, buy the ready-assembled automotive-minded units from MP3CAR.com

 

In the last 4.5 years doing this I've done and hacked bodywork and PC cases and cursed more than any of you CarPC-wise. I just dropped 520 on something readily assembled, tested and warrantied from MP3CAR. And yes, there is a difference. I guess due to repeated failiures I gained anough proficiency with regards to the software to have a decent final product on the software side and by sticking to Intel-based products, I could just move the old Win XP n-lite / CF3.1 / IG4 / GMPC over to the new mo-bo and fix the drivers, boot.ini and the GUI.

 

But I am so done with hacking boxes, adding switches, soldering wires etc. It is a phucking money pit, nothing better evidenced by the fact that I wasted another 520 on it. I will never again do a CarPC project. In the long run it is more money (twice $$$ - so far for me) and countless man-hours wasted then what an AVIC-N1 would have cost back in 2007.

If Centrafuse would get their software working properly that would resolve many of the problems. It's damn near the cost of the OS but full of bugs. RoadRunner is better but with so many people contributing to it it is inevitable that you'll install something that screws it all up.

 

Hardware wise things aren't much better. In the OEM world, all the Navi system functions are integrated into one nice little box under the seat. In the aftermarket, you're stuck with sticking little boxes for various functions all over your car and going crazy with USB cords all over the place. Recipe for disaster, IMO.

 

There's a reason OEM systems cost $2000+. They work.

 

My friend has a Hyundai. OEM radio plays music from his iPod, mutes it when a call comes in, the bluetooth works properly, etc...

 

The boys over at Centrafuse are still stuck on trying to get the BlueSoleil to stay activated.
